As the name implies, Summoners summon Summons, people from another world. Summoners do this to form contracts with whatever they invoke. The details of these contracts vary, but the result is a Summoner gaining an ally and exploring an alternate world for the summon.   There are a couple of crucial things for a Summoner to remember. One, a summon can not stay out permanently. They run off of a Summoner's mana supply like a battery. If they do anything that requires magical power, they will passively take from their Summoner's mana supply. If they're out of mana, they summon disappears. Although, once a summoner gets strong enough, the creature can stay out without passively draining them.   On the topic of mana, when a summon takes a deadly wound, they can use their Summoner's mana to stay out longer to protect them. Ordinarily, a Summon would return to the summoning world to heal themselves. Because of this, some summoners get the idea that a Summon is invincible. However, this is far from the truth. They're sentient living creatures who feel pain and can die. To die, they need to pass away in the summoning world. Although if a Summon dies in the material world, they would need to regenerate their bodies, which takes a few days.   Understanding that a Summon is alive comes realizing what it means to be a summoner. Summon and Summoner form a between them. Whatever type of relationship or dynamic they have, the two must try to know one another better. How much you know about your Summons and view them, and vice versa, will determine your summoning career. So happy summoning summoner.

Career

Qualifications

For one, a Summoner needs to be knowledgeable in summoning magic to qualify as one. Then, they need to have a Summon to officially be recognized as Summoner.

Career Progression

Like all classes, Summoners can rank up into advanced versions of themselves. However, summoners have three pathways they can go down.   The first pathway is Keidirn. Keidirn is a summoner who decided to form a pact with a powerful entity. This pathway gives exclusive summons relating to them and using power from your new boss. The master class version is Redistoc. Redistoc has now gained the respect of their patron without suffering ill side effects.   The second pathway is Glyph Crafter. These are summoners who learned more about summoning circles and can now defend themselves without their summons. Finally, the master class version is Glyph Magi. Glyph Magi is a direct upgrade to the class while also giving them their summoning circle.   The third pathway is Incarnate. These summoners have formed a deep connection with their summons, allowing them to share power to create exciting effects—the master class version of this, Conduit. Conduit erases the title of a summoner, and a summon as they now fight as a singular force in battle.

Payment & Reimbursement

Like most adventurers, Summoners get paid by completing quests. Typically in XP, GP, and items.

Other Benefits

The main benefit of being a summoner is the ability to bring out your allies whenever you want. However, the benefits extend further out depending on your bond. A summon may teach you a few things, bring you items, or offer you a trip to their world. These also depend on the person in question.

Perception

Purpose

The purpose of a summoner largely depends on what they summoned. Since no two summons is the same and has vastly different abilities, there are many roles a summoner could fit. However, a large number of summoners end up being magical DPS.

Social Status

Summoners are unique in the aspect of calling another being to help them. As a result, people are often curious about their summons and abilities. Some even want to emulate the fact by either trying to learn it themselves or taming a creature.   On the flip side, people might ignore a summoner if their summon is not particularly interesting or powerful to them. On the other hand, if a summoner does have a powerful one, people might end up valuing the summon more than the summoner. Then there's the case of everyone being wary of some summoners since some are bad at controlling their summons.

Operations

Tools

Summoners aren't entirely defenseless without their summon. They begin with paper tags and light armor. These paper tags carry magic and can help out a summoner in a pinch. Some summoners also have on them some writing utensils and paper. Some use these items to perform a "proper summoning"; however, it is unneeded if you have already formed a pact.

Dangers & Hazards

Ironically, the most significant hazard to being a summoner is themselves. If a summoner angers a summon, there's a chance they will ignore them, attack them, or break the contract in some circumstances.
